Music video by Soulvizion: http://soulvizion.com Taking his already astounding career to the next level in helping champion new music via his own avenue, Lost Frequencies is proud to announce Found Frequencies, his own, debut label distributed by Armada Music that will release its first track ‘Crazy’ with Zonderling, an energetic combination coming from these two artists great creative arsenals. A sunshine-ready track to warm up the winter months with a new twist on Lost Frequencies’ adored house sound, ‘Crazy’ is individualistic and captivating with a sing-a-long chorus that enchanted at its debut live Tomorrowland debut. With lyrics including “I don’t care what the world says” and asking “so what if I am crazy?”, that wrap around bouncing synth lines, ‘Crazy’ is a future classic that is sure to stand the test of time amongst some of Lost Frequencies biggest back catalogue hits, and the perfect anthem to inaugurate the Found Frequencies venture.
